Book Collecting as an Investment: A Strategic Guide

Building a valuable book collection is more than just accumulating books; it's a strategic investment. Start by defining your collecting focus. Are you interested in a specific author, genre, or historical period? A well-defined focus allows you to concentrate your resources and develop expertise.

Research and Due Diligence

Thorough research is essential. Learn about the authors, publishers, and illustrators whose works you collect. Understand the factors that influence a book's value, such as rarity, condition, and provenance. Consult auction records, dealer catalogs, and online databases to track prices and identify potential acquisitions. Consider joining a book collectors society for insights.

Strategic Acquisitions

Seek out undervalued gems. Sometimes, lesser-known works by established authors or books in overlooked genres offer excellent investment potential. Attend book fairs and auctions, but be prepared to bid strategically. Don't be afraid to negotiate, and always inspect books carefully before making a purchase. Diversify your collection to mitigate risk, and stay current with book market trends.

Consider the long-term appreciation potential of your collection. Books, like fine art, can appreciate significantly over time, particularly if they are rare, well-preserved, and historically significant.

Building a valuable book collection requires patience, knowledge, and a keen eye for opportunity. By following these guidelines, you can transform your passion for books into a rewarding and potentially lucrative investment.
